Practical Tips for Makers and Designers
While Cryabo is fantastic for headlines and display use, it is important to remember its strengths. It is best suited for titles, logos, and short decorative wording rather than long blocks of body text. For longer descriptions, such as the back of a book or a detailed instruction sheet, pair it with a highly readable sans serif font or a neutral script font to maintain balance. This contrast keeps the design dynamic and easy to navigate.
Before launching your new product line, always check the specific file formats and licensing included with your download. Most commercial font licenses allow for unlimited physical end-products, which is perfect for selling candles, shirts, or printed stationery. However, if you plan to sell the font file itself or editable templates where the end-user can modify the text, you may need an extended license. Always verify these details to protect your small business.
Additionally, take advantage of any alternates or stylistic sets if they are available in the full version. Sometimes swapping a standard 'A' for an alternate glyph can add a unique touch to a logo design or a monogram. Testing your designs in real-world scenarios is crucial. Print a sample label, stick it on the actual container, and view it from different angles. Does the Cryabo text stand out? Does it complement the material of the packaging? These small checks ensure that your final product looks as good in hand as it does on the screen.
